          No that's all good. If you're seeing any text at all then the cable is working.
          Usually the serial console software running whatever you're attached to received what you're typing and echoes back whatever is appropriate including moving to a new line and the CLI prompt etc. Just connecting Rx and Tx you are seeing simply the raw output of the serial terminal.

          So that has proved Putty and the USB-Serial converter are working correctly. It has proved the serial cable you using has pins 2 and 3 connected BUT it has not proved that it's a null-modem cable and not a straight through cable since pins 2 and 3 could be connected either way. However since you have a multimeter it's easy to prove.  :) In a null-modem cable (of any type) pins 2 and 3 are crossed in the cable such that pin 2 at one end is connected to pin 3 at the other. Using two paperclips and the meter on it's continuity range (often beeps when connected) you can test this.

                          I've never seen an APU board so I've no idea which leds should light up. The manual just says three. Perhaps check the pc-engines forum.
                          The power requirement is 6-12W so that's 0.5-1A. Your psu shohld be fine.
                          Some serial consoles require hardware flow control. You may not have putty set for that. Your cable may not be wired for it. Once booting pfSense though it's not a problem. You should see pfSense output at 9600bps.

                                      Ok, that's no good you can't just copy the file to the card you have to write it as a raw image bit for bit (after you've ungzipped it).
                                      To do that try using Win 32 disk imager: http://sourceforge.net/projects/win32diskimager/

                                      There are some great step by step instructions on the forum somewhere. I think they're in the APU thread.
